Young Tanzanian reggae singer Man Sniper (also spelled Mansnipa or Mansnepa) has been working with Dutch reggae group the Rootsriders to record his first album. In November 2008 he visited the African hip hop radio studio together with Cyril from the Rootsriders, where he spoke about his music and did a little freestyle. Then there’s an interview we recorded with Rich Medina at BASS festival in UK in June 2008.

The show also features a report by the late Angel Wainana from Ghetto Radio in Nairobi about the refusal of members of parliament to pay taxes. Also in the studio: Tanzanian dj G-Town who lives in Rotterdam. In the 3rd hour he took over from dj 360 to do a mix of Bongo flava and other East African music.

Note: this show was recorded for the Dutch edition of African hip hop radio. Presentation is in Dutch, the interviews are in English (and Swahili). Also, the last few tracks of the 1st hour are not part of the African hip hop radio playlist (see below), they were added because of a technical failure at the studio…
